A highly skilled, communication-focused UI Developer / Accessibility Expert is needed for the digital modernization team at the Department of Management (DOM) Division of Information Technology (DoIT) in Des Moines. This specialist will focus entirely on user interfaces and accessibility, collaborating with a lead UX Architect and accessibility expert to scale high-quality digital standards across the enterprise.
Core Responsibilities- Author clean, well-structured, and highly maintainable HTML and CSS/SASS that complies with modern web standards.
- Integrate frontend user interfaces into Angular or MVC .NET frameworks.
- Implement digital accessibility from the ground up, utilizing WCAG standards, ARIA labels, and proper color contrast to ensure all digital services are universally accessible to all Iowans.
- Partner with the lead UX Architect to follow strategic architectural guidance and scale technical accessibility standards across enterprise-level initiatives, including chatbot interfaces and global state footers.
- Collaborate effectively with cross-functional agency teams, clearly articulating technical frontend requirements, standards, and best practices.
Skills & Qualifications
- Deep expertise in writing clean, semantic HTML5 and modern, responsive CSS/SASS.
- Proven experience implementing WCAG standards, managing ARIA landmarks/attributes, and resolving color contrast or screen‑reader compatibility issues.
- Demonstrated ability to integrate front‑end assets into Angular or MVC .NET environments.
- Strong communicator, able to clearly explain frontend engineering concepts, WCAG requirements, and technical standards to both technical team members and agency stakeholders.
- Experience working with established design systems or wrapper components.
- Direct experience utilizing or extending the U.S. Web Design System (USWDS).
- Foundational understanding of user experience (UX) principles and design workflows.
